Choo Choo! We jumped on the MK train from Toon Town heading towards Frontierland! Because there is no room on the train, you have to leave your stroller so we unloaded and left our double stroller behind. Once we arrived in Frontierland, we were suppose to be able to just pick up a new double stroller upon getting off, but all the doubles were taken, so we were forced to take a single. Kind of a bummer! I am sure we could have found a CM and made an issue out of it...but I had a roller coaster to ride!!:banana:

My in-laws took the kids to Liberty Square while Chris and I boarded Thunder Mountain! I was a little nervous, but overall pretty excited. **If you did not read Part 1, this is my first time on a coaster!** I loved the ride! It was a little jerky but I really enjoyed the theme. I think that is what makes Disney rides so enjoyable! It feels like you are watching a show and riding a ride. We walked to Liberty to meet the in-laws and the kids. They were at the Christmas Ornament shop. We went in and bought a couple of ornaments to remember the trip. Abby got a Cinderella, I got a Castle and then we got a Mickey Ear with "2008" written on it by hand. We decided this should be a tradition every year.
